Q: Is 6,262,023 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 6,262,023 is a composite number.

Why is 6,262,023 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 6,262,023 can be evenly divided by 1 3 149 447 14,009 42,027 2,087,341 and 6,262,023, with no remainder.

Since 6,262,023 cannot be divided by just 1 and 6,262,023, it is a composite number.
